Startup from Rio Connects Rio Innovation Week 2022 Audience Using Clean Energy.

Those who participated in Rio Innovation Week, from November 8 to 11, at Pier Mauá in the capital of Rio de Janeiro, had the opportunity to see the main technological and innovative solutions developed in the country.
One of them is the startup Flying to the Sun, born from a subsidiary of Ergon Projetos, a company rooted in the architecture and interior design market. An estimated 125,000 people strolled through the four days of the event, sharing experiences, doing business and most importantly, discussing new ways to connect.
With smart, connectable and sustainable products, the startup was present at RIW 2022, supported by Sebrae Nacional. Event attendees had the opportunity to visit the solar tree and sunbeds, referred to as “smart stations” and “sunbeds”, where they could rest, connect to Wi-Fi and charge their cell phones or other devices; In addition to ordering chilled water for Cedae, a water supply company in Rio de Janeiro, which has partnered to work through the virtual assistant available through QR CODE.

With the support of Sebrae, the startup also participated in international events in France and Germany. With the solar tree, the company won the JEC Awards Innovation Award 2019, in the Renewable Energy category, when it was selected as one of the 450 best sustainable collaborative projects in the world, during a ceremony which s is held in South Korea.

The startup is also betting on sustainability by producing bags capable of capturing energy from the sun and, thanks to a database, supplying energy for various things. Made with chemical fabric and glued with cassava glue, this supplement took part in an exhibition in France, and also attracted attention during an exhibition at the Museum of Tomorrow.
The company also produces other adaptable products for smart cities, such as solar-powered gazebos that integrate with virtual voice assistants, Wi-Fi and USB outlets, among other technologies.
